Randburg’s Unique Climate Profile

Randburg experiences warm, wet summers and cool, dry winters. The area receives approximately 56.02 millimeters of precipitation annually. Rain falls for about 94.3 days throughout the year.

These conditions create specific demands on paving materials. Materials must withstand moisture exposure during rainy seasons. They also need to handle temperature fluctuations year-round.

Temperature Variations and Thermal Stress

Temperature variations play a crucial role in material selection. Randburg experiences significant daily and seasonal temperature differences. These cause expansion and contraction in paving materials.

Materials that cannot accommodate thermal movements develop problems. Common issues include cracks, uneven surfaces, and joint separation. The area’s intense UV exposure during summer months adds another challenge. Some materials fade, become brittle, or lose structural integrity.

Soil Conditions and Foundation Challenges

Soil conditions in Randburg add complexity to paving decisions. Clay-rich soils are common in the region. These soils expand when wet and contract when dry.

This movement creates unstable foundations for paving. It’s essential to choose appropriate materials and installation methods. The solution must accommodate ground movement without compromising surface integrity.

Clay Pavers: Traditional Beauty Meets Durability

Manufacturing Process and Material Properties

Clay pavers offer timeless aesthetic appeal and proven durability. These pavers are manufactured from natural clay materials. They’re fired at extremely high temperatures, creating dense, strong products. The process develops character over time.

Natural variations in clay paver coloring create beautiful surfaces. The texture appears organic and complements various landscape designs. Both traditional and contemporary styles work well with clay pavers.

Thermal Performance in Randburg’s Climate

One significant advantage is excellent thermal performance in Randburg’s climate. Clay materials naturally regulate temperature fluctuations better than alternatives. They remain cooler in summer heat. They provide better freeze-thaw resistance during winter temperature drops.

This thermal stability reduces expansion and contraction stresses. These stresses often lead to cracking and joint separation. Clay pavers are particularly suitable for areas with significant temperature variations.

Water Management and Drainage Benefits

Clay pavers offer superior water management properties. Their natural porosity allows controlled water absorption and release. This prevents surface water buildup during Randburg’s rainy season.

The drainage capability reduces water-related damage risks. Efflorescence occurs when mineral salts migrate to surfaces. This creates unsightly white deposits. Natural firing makes clay pavers highly resistant to chemical damage. They withstand acid rain and environmental pollutants well.

Aesthetic Longevity and Property Value

Clay pavers age gracefully from an aesthetic perspective. They develop a natural patina that enhances appearance over time. Unlike materials that fade or deteriorate, clay pavers become more beautiful as they weather. This makes them an excellent long-term investment for properties prioritizing landscaping excellence.

Cost and Availability Considerations

Clay pavers do have considerations for Randburg homeowners. They typically represent a higher initial investment than concrete alternatives. Availability in specific colors and styles may be more limited.

Clay pavers require careful installation for optimal results. Proper drainage and joint stability are essential. This is particularly important in areas with challenging soil conditions.

Concrete Pavers: Modern Innovation and Versatility

Engineering and Manufacturing Advantages

Concrete pavers represent modern engineering solutions. They offer exceptional versatility and performance characteristics. These pavers use controlled concrete mixtures designed for specific requirements. They meet strength, durability, and aesthetic needs.

Modern concrete paver technology has advanced significantly. Current products rival traditional materials in appearance and longevity. They often provide superior performance in challenging conditions.

Consistency and Predictable Performance

The primary advantage in Randburg’s climate lies in engineered consistency. Concrete pavers deliver predictable performance. Unlike natural materials with inherent variations, concrete pavers meet precise specifications. This ensures uniform strength, water absorption rates, and dimensional stability.

This consistency makes them particularly reliable in challenging conditions. They perform well in difficult soil conditions and extreme weather exposure.

Superior Moisture Management Systems

Concrete pavers excel in moisture management during Randburg’s wet season. Modern designs incorporate specific drainage features. They include controlled porosity that efficiently manages surface water. Internal damage prevention is a key benefit.

Many concrete pavers include integrated water management systems. These work seamlessly with proper base preparation. They prevent water-related problems like settling, shifting, and surface deterioration.

Design Flexibility and Aesthetic Options

The design flexibility makes concrete pavers attractive for contemporary landscapes. They can be manufactured in virtually any color, texture, or pattern. This allows creative installations that complement modern artificial turf applications.

Design versatility extends to functional considerations. Options include different slip-resistance levels and load-bearing capacities. Specialized applications like permeable paving systems are available.

Maintenance and Repair Benefits

Concrete pavers offer practical maintenance and repair advantages. Individual pavers can be easily removed and replaced if damaged. This doesn’t affect the surrounding installation. This repairability is valuable where ground movement might cause occasional issues.

Concrete pavers can be cleaned and restored using standard procedures. Long-term care is straightforward and cost-effective.

Environmental Considerations

The manufacturing process allows incorporation of recycled materials. Environmentally conscious production methods are possible. Many manufacturers offer products with significant recycled content. This makes them environmentally responsible choices for sustainable landscape design projects.

Climate-Specific Performance Analysis

When evaluating paver materials specifically for Randburg’s climate conditions, several performance factors become particularly important. Water management capabilities rank among the most critical considerations, given the area’s substantial seasonal rainfall and the potential for rapid weather changes. Both clay and concrete pavers offer good water management properties, but they achieve this through different mechanisms.

Clay pavers manage moisture through natural porosity and thermal regulation. Their ability to absorb and release moisture gradually helps prevent surface water accumulation and reduces the thermal shock that can occur when hot surfaces are suddenly exposed to cool rainwater. This gradual moisture management also helps prevent the rapid expansion and contraction cycles that can damage paving installations.

Concrete pavers approach water management through engineered design features. Modern concrete pavers often incorporate specific drainage channels, controlled porosity, and surface textures designed to efficiently move water away from the paved surface. Some concrete paver systems include permeable designs that allow water to pass through the paver itself, providing superior drainage for areas prone to water accumulation.

Temperature stability represents another crucial performance factor in Randburg’s climate. The area’s temperature variations require paving materials that can accommodate thermal expansion and contraction without developing structural problems. Clay pavers naturally handle these temperature changes through their thermal mass and gradual temperature adjustment. Concrete pavers address thermal stability through controlled expansion joints and engineered material compositions that minimize dimensional changes.

UV resistance becomes particularly important during Randburg’s intense summer months. Clay pavers offer natural UV protection through their fired ceramic surface, which actually becomes more durable with sun exposure. Concrete pavers achieve UV resistance through surface treatments and integral coloring systems that penetrate throughout the material, preventing surface fading and deterioration.

Installation and Maintenance Considerations

The success of any paving installation depends heavily on proper installation techniques and ongoing maintenance practices. In Randburg’s challenging soil conditions, foundation preparation becomes particularly critical for long-term performance. Both clay and concrete pavers require substantial base preparation, including proper excavation, drainage installation, and base material compaction.

Clay paver installation typically requires more specialized knowledge and techniques, particularly regarding joint materials and drainage systems. The natural variations in clay pavers may require more careful sorting and layout planning to achieve uniform appearance and performance. However, once properly installed, clay pavers generally require less ongoing maintenance and develop improved performance characteristics over time.

Concrete paver installation often follows more standardized procedures, with consistent material properties that simplify planning and execution. The uniform nature of concrete pavers allows for more predictable installation schedules and material requirements. Installation crews familiar with concrete paver systems can often complete projects more efficiently while maintaining high quality standards.

Maintenance requirements differ significantly between the two materials. Clay pavers typically require minimal routine maintenance, with occasional cleaning and joint material replenishment being the primary ongoing needs. Their natural aging process actually improves their appearance and performance over time, making them essentially maintenance-free for many applications.

Concrete pavers may require more regular maintenance to preserve their appearance and performance. This can include periodic cleaning, sealing applications, and joint material maintenance. However, the ability to easily remove and replace individual concrete pavers provides flexibility for addressing localized problems without major reconstruction.

Cost Analysis and Long-Term Value

When comparing clay pavers and concrete pavers for Randburg installations, cost considerations extend well beyond initial material prices. A comprehensive cost analysis must include material costs, installation expenses, ongoing maintenance requirements, and long-term durability expectations. This total cost of ownership approach provides a more accurate picture of each material’s true economic value.

Initial material costs typically favor concrete pavers, which are generally less expensive per square meter than clay alternatives. However, this cost difference may be offset by differences in installation requirements, with clay pavers sometimes requiring more specialized installation techniques that increase labor costs. The availability of materials also affects pricing, with locally manufactured concrete pavers often providing cost advantages over imported clay products.

Installation costs can vary significantly based on site conditions, design complexity, and contractor experience. Complex patterns or specialized drainage requirements may favor one material over another depending on the specific project requirements. For properties requiring integration with professional landscaping services, the choice of paving material should complement the overall landscape design and maintenance program.

Long-term value considerations often favor clay pavers due to their durability and minimal maintenance requirements. While the initial investment may be higher, clay pavers can provide decades of service with minimal ongoing costs. Their natural aging process actually improves their appearance over time, potentially adding to property values rather than detracting from them.

Concrete pavers offer good long-term value through their repairability and consistent performance. The ability to replace individual pavers without major reconstruction can significantly reduce long-term maintenance costs. Additionally, the wide availability of concrete pavers ensures that replacement materials will remain accessible for future repairs or additions.
